AWS SDK for Go (PILOT)
API Reference

PREVIEW DOCUMENTATION - This is a preview of a new format for the AWS SDK for Go API Reference documentation. For the current AWS SDK for Go API Reference, see https://docs.aws.amazon.com/sdk-for-go/api/.

We welcome your feedback on this new version of the documentation. Send your comments to aws-sdkdocs-feedback@amazon.com.

BacktrackDBClusterOutput

import "github.com/aws/aws-sdk-go/service/rds"

type BacktrackDBClusterOutput struct { BacktrackIdentifier *string `type:"string"` BacktrackRequestCreationTime *time.Time `type:"timestamp"` BacktrackTo *time.Time `type:"timestamp"` BacktrackedFrom *time.Time `type:"timestamp"` DBClusterIdentifier *string `type:"string"` Status *string `type:"string"` }

This data type is used as a response element in the DescribeDBClusterBacktracks action.

BacktrackIdentifier

Type: *string

Contains the backtrack identifier.

BacktrackRequestCreationTime

Type: *time.Time

The timestamp of the time at which the backtrack was requested.

BacktrackTo

Type: *time.Time

The timestamp of the time to which the DB cluster was backtracked.

BacktrackedFrom

Type: *time.Time

The timestamp of the time from which the DB cluster was backtracked.

DBClusterIdentifier

Type: *string

Contains a user-supplied DB cluster identifier. This identifier is the unique key that identifies a DB cluster.

Status

Type: *string

The status of the backtrack. This property returns one of the following values:

  • applying - The backtrack is currently being applied to or rolled back from the DB cluster.

  • completed - The backtrack has successfully been applied to or rolled back from the DB cluster.

  • failed - An error occurred while the backtrack was applied to or rolled back from the DB cluster.

  • pending - The backtrack is currently pending application to or rollback from the DB cluster.

Method

GoString

func (s BacktrackDBClusterOutput) GoString() string

GoString returns the string representation

SetBacktrackIdentifier

func (s *BacktrackDBClusterOutput) SetBacktrackIdentifier(v string) *BacktrackDBClusterOutput

SetBacktrackIdentifier sets the BacktrackIdentifier field's value.

SetBacktrackRequestCreationTime

func (s *BacktrackDBClusterOutput) SetBacktrackRequestCreationTime(v time.Time) *BacktrackDBClusterOutput

SetBacktrackRequestCreationTime sets the BacktrackRequestCreationTime field's value.

SetBacktrackTo

func (s *BacktrackDBClusterOutput) SetBacktrackTo(v time.Time) *BacktrackDBClusterOutput

SetBacktrackTo sets the BacktrackTo field's value.

SetBacktrackedFrom

func (s *BacktrackDBClusterOutput) SetBacktrackedFrom(v time.Time) *BacktrackDBClusterOutput

SetBacktrackedFrom sets the BacktrackedFrom field's value.

SetDBClusterIdentifier

func (s *BacktrackDBClusterOutput) SetDBClusterIdentifier(v string) *BacktrackDBClusterOutput

SetDBClusterIdentifier sets the DBClusterIdentifier field's value.

SetStatus

func (s *BacktrackDBClusterOutput) SetStatus(v string) *BacktrackDBClusterOutput

SetStatus sets the Status field's value.

String

func (s BacktrackDBClusterOutput) String() string

String returns the string representation

On this page: